Frequently Asked Questions
- Is this suitable for bathrooms and kitchens?
Yes, this product can be installed in areas with humidity as long as the walls are smooth, clean, and dry. For extra durability, avoid direct water exposure or steam-heavy environments. - Can I reposition or reuse after removing?
Panels can be adjusted multiple times during installation. However, they’re not intended to be reused after full removal, as the adhesive strength may diminish. - Will peel wallpaper damage my painted walls?
When applied to the recommended surfaces, peel wallpaper remains wall safe and leaves no sticky residue, according to NuWallpaper’s product site. - What’s the best way to prep before installation?
Wipe the wall with a dry, lint-free cloth to remove dust and ensure the area is fully dry. Avoid using on textured, damp, or non-stick paint surfaces to ensure the best adhesion. - How much area does one roll cover?
Each roll covers about 30.75 sq. ft., making it a great choice for accent walls, small rooms, or lining furniture.
